I've just got a copy of Apache Longbow, and tried running on my Win98 machine.

Software version runs fine, but I want to try to 3dfx version. Machine has 2 Voodoo 2's running in SLI. I've installed the 3dfx-enabled version of Longbow, I can change the program settings [under Preferences] but when I try to run Arcade [say] the computer locks with a black screen [can just make out the 3dfx logo].

Any ideas? Do I need to not run Win98 but Win95? Could it be a DirectX problem - I have 8.1 installed whereas the game comes with a version much older? I have tried turning off SLI and limiting memory for glide apps to 2mb. No joy.

The Voodoo drivers are the Creative originals, which work on everything else [including AvP, which is cr@p on my pachine if I use FastVoodoo2-4-6 drivers].

i beleive you put the following in autoexec.bat

set SST_GRXCLK=50
set SST_FT_CLK_DEL=0x4
set SST_TF0_CLK_DEL=0x6
set SST_TF1_CLK_DEL=0x6
set SST_VIN_CLKDEL=0x1
set SST_VOUT_CLKDEL=0x0
set SST_TMUMEM_SIZE=2
